CVE-2026-61792: CWE-22: Improper Limitation of a Pathname to a Restricted Directory ('Path Traversal') in WeblateOrg weblateCVE-2026-61792 0 Weblate is a web-based continuous localization platform used to manage software translations. In versions prior to 2026.7, a project administrator can read files outside their repository through the App store metadata download feature, which resolves attacker-influenced paths without adequately confining them to the repository. This is an incomplete fix for CVE-2026-34242, whose original patch failed to fully prevent the path traversal, allowing the arbitrary file read to persist. A user with project-administrator privileges can therefore disclose the contents of files on the Weblate host that lie outside the project's repository. This issue is fixed in version 2026.7.
